Meet Diesel 🔥🐾 4 years old · Cocker Spaniel/Basset Hound mix · 55 lbs · Neutered Male Powered by zoomies, treats, and pure joy Diesel arrived at the shelter on December 23 after a house fire displaced his previous owner. He came in with his canine companion Dolly through no fault of his own and now finds himself looking for a second home. Diesel is a four year old spaniel and hound mix weighing about fifty five pounds. True to his name, Diesel has an engine that starts slow and runs strong. He can be a bit cautious at first and does best with calm, patient introductions where he is allowed to approach on his own terms. Once he warms up, his personality comes to life in the best way. Diesel is goofy, affectionate, and full of enthusiasm. In the yard, he loves to run with a ball or stick in his mouth and will happily invite you to chase him if you can keep up. He has impressive speed and zoomies that are guaranteed to make you laugh. When playtime winds down, Diesel is just as content staying close to his people, enjoying treats and leaning in for his absolute favorite thing, butt scratches. On leash, Diesel is still learning the ropes but with consistency, positive reinforcement, and patience, he continues to make progress and is eager to learn. Diesel has previously lived with another dog and has shown positive social behavior around other dogs. A meet and greet is required if there is another dog in the home. Diesel is not good with cats and would do best in a cat free home.
